What Mora Does

Mora acts as a secure, on-device data store for your MCP agents. It facilitates the integration of personal communication and scheduling data, transforming it into actionable insights. Specifically, Mora processes data from Gmail, Calendar, and iMessage to construct comprehensive entity graphs. These graphs allow agents to understand relationships between people, events, and communications. Furthermore, Mora generates daily briefs, summarizing key information and tasks derived from this integrated data, enabling agents to provide more contextually relevant assistance.
